Output d13e2a78a67d06ef1fa68da02da40ee1072105d2de979cb0adbe368456ef70d4:8

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fae9dd4b38d45afd6f42da128be0bc29bde636c OP_EQUAL
address
3EnjjYXuFPCWyns9fcSg3ZZn2mqKzVwaD6
transaction
d13e2a78a67d06ef1fa68da02da40ee1072105d2de979cb0adbe368456ef70d4
confirmations
409651
spent
true